Nollywood actor and director Frederick Leonard has take to social media to bemoan the persistent foul smell that comes from some actors while on set.

He queried why some individuals fail to use deodorants on a job that requires their constant movement and contact with others.

Frederick shared instances where he had to face people with body odour.

In his rant, he urged crew members to use deodorants, mint or gum to combat their poor hygiene.

Leonard wrote: “Any Human being That Has A FUNCTIONING BRAIN Wether Cast or Crew, should Use Deodorants. And touch up Again by 5. pm so you don’t begin to smell like rotten Goat.

“For a Profession that requires that we are Constantly on our Feet for a minimum of 14 hours, COMMON SENSE SHOULD APPLY.. And Let’s not Forget Mint or Gum to Fight Mouth Odor. Thank You.”
